Enhanced chronic inflammation and reduced insulin sensitivity are often present in chronic kidney disease (CKD). Cardiovascular disease remains a major cause of morbidity and mortality in end-stage renal patients. Adiponectin (ADP) is a hormone exclusively produced by adipocytes and possesses anti-inflammatory and cardioprotective properties. Despite the high prevalence of insulin resistance and cardiovascular disease, levels of ADP are increased among end-stage renal disease patients on hemo or peritoneal dialysis but also among patients with moderate renal failure or with the nephrotic syndrome. Furthermore, lower ADP levels are associated with poor cardiovascular outcome. In this review, we examine ADP modifications in CKD and discuss the different factors that may have an impact on this adipokine metabolism in renal failure.  相似文献

BACKGROUND: An imbalance in the ratio of arachidonic acid and docosahexaenoic acid (DHA) was found in cystic fibrosis (CF) affected tissues and was suggested to promote inflammation. Several studies have shown that the long chain n-3 fatty acids reduced inflammatory activity while others have highlighted prooxidant activity of DHA at high concentrations. The aim of our study was to evaluate the effects of an intravenous fish-oil emulsion enriched with n-3 FA in patients with CF on plasma and platelet FA composition and peroxidation markers. METHODS: 13 patients with CF received one IV emulsion per week of 2 mL/kg fish-oil n-3 emulsion for 12 weeks. RESULTS: There was a significant increase in 20:5 n-3 and 22:6 n-3 platelet FA composition, no variation in 20:4 n-6, a decrease in n-9. There was no variation in plasma FA composition. Specific urinary markers of lipid peroxidation derived from n-3 and n-6 showed a very high level before infusion compared with usual values in healthy subjects which was not affected by treatment. A significant weight loss and a decrease in reduced glutathione were observed in adult patients. CONCLUSIONS: The intravenous administration of n-3 FA in CF patients induced a significant modification in platelet FA composition but no modification of oxidative markers. However, the weight loss and the decreased level in reduced glutathione observed in adult patients may suggest a potential deleterious activity for some patients. Further studies are necessary to determine the optimal dose and route for long chain FA administration required to reach a potential beneficial effect.  相似文献

The expression of MHC isoforms in the skeletal muscles of nine patients with Duchenne muscular dystrophy (DMD) (from 2.5 to 15 yr of age) and three DMD carriers was studied using different specific anti-MHC MAbs. We also analyzed muscle fiber size and fiber reactivity with acridine orange and/or with a surface antigen marker. One-quarter of all fibers of DMD patients, or less with age, were of normal size and contained only adult slow MHC. Half of the muscle fibers contained adult and developmental MHCs. Only half of these fibers were representative of an active regenerative process. MHC co-expression also altered the proportion of normal fast or slow fibers. Adult fast MHCs were expressed as unique MHC only in small and very small fibers in the oldest DMD patients. In DMD carrier muscles, the greatest alterations in MHC expression were observed in patients with the most reduced dystrophin expression. However, MHC changes in dystrophin-positive fibers were similar to those observed in dystrophin-free fibers. In conclusion, disruptions or delays in the switching of all genes coding for adult fast and slow MHC and developmental MHC coincided with dystrophin deletion and with perturbations in its expression.  相似文献

The German Infectious Disease Control Act of 2001 includes a modified regulation for reporting infectious diseases and infectious pathogens and new clauses for surveillance and infection control in medical institutions. For the first time, all health care facilities are obliged to conduct surveillance of nosocomial infections and multiresistant pathogens. This legal regulation including mandatory monitoring by local health departments aims at reducing the rates of nosocomial infection and frequency and dissemination of highly resistant pathogens. This article describes the effect of the Disease Control Act on surgical departments. Surveillance of postsurgical wound infection should lead to better understanding of the cause and effect of nosocomial infection and greater acceptance of high-quality hospital hygiene management.  相似文献

We analyzed performance and efficiency of the left ventricular myocardium on the basis of two new energetic parameters. The myocardial energy consumed during one cardiac cycle is related to performed work on the one hand (E1) and to the stress-time-integral on the other (E2). E1 was obtained by analysis of the pressure-volume integral divided by left ventricular muscle mass. E2 was obtained as follows: the stress-time integral was analyzed from pressure-volume data and wall thickness using an ellipsoidal calculation model. In order to transfer the stress-time integral into energy units, the value was multiplied by a constant factor which was obtained in experimental myothermal studies. In ten patients with coronary heart disease undergoing diagnostic heart catheterization, angiocardiography was performed before and after oral administration of nitroglycerin (1.6 mg). Total energy consumption (2E1 + E2) per gram myocardium per beat decreased from 6.1 +/- 1.3 mcal/g to 4.7 +/- 1.4 mcal/g (P less than 0.01), and myocardial efficiency (E1/[2E1 + E2]) increased from 27.0 +/- 3.1% to 28.4 +/- 4.3% (N.S.) on the average. This analysis explains quantitatively the beneficial effect of nitro-preparations on myocardial function and energetics.  相似文献

Pericardial puncture is the percutaneous insertion of a needle into the pericardial space to drain a pathological pericardial effusion. The challenge for the operating surgeon is to reach percutaneously a target zone in the vicinity of the mobile heart, in a soft-tissue environment. The surgeon's ability to accomplish this depends on his own mental picture of the effusion. CASPER is a navigation software using an optical localizer which assists the surgeon by enhancing the representation of the effusion and guiding the needle's progress. Using a localized and calibrated echographic probe, the surgeon acquires a set of images in the region of interest. This zone is then manually segmented on each image, a common zone is computed, and the surgeon defines a trajectory for the needle. During the puncture procedure, the surgeon follows the position of the localized needle on a computer monitor. After initial validation on an experimental phantom, a feasibility study was performed using canine and porcine models. The optical localization device was changed from an Optotrak to a Polaris device for easier use in the clinical setting. Prior to clinical application, various tests were performed concerning the mobility of the thoracic cage, the reproducibility of the thoracic position over several apneas, and the stability of anatomic structures relative to the thoracic cage. Finally, a first clinical application was successfully performed using this system. The present paper reports on these last two stages.  相似文献

We present a case of aggressive fibromatosis of the scalene and longus colli muscles with surgically proved secondary involvement of the brachial plexus and carotid sheath in a 29-year-old woman in whom MR imaging failed to show involvement of the carotid sheath. The well-defined lesion was isointense on T1-weighted images and hyperintense on T2-weighted images relative to adjacent normal muscle and enhanced brightly.  相似文献

Visual recognition in monkeys appears to involve the participation of two limbothalamic pathways, one including the amygdala and the magnocellular portion of the medial dorsal nucleus (MDmc) and the other, the hippocampus and the anterior nuclei of the thalamus (Ant N). Both MDmc and Ant N project, in turn, to the prefrontal cortex, mainly to its ventral and medial portions. To test whether the prefrontal projection targets of the two limbothalamic pathways also participate in memory functions, performance on a variety of learning and memory tasks was assessed in monkeys with lesions of the ventromedial prefrontal cortex (Group VM). Normal monkeys and monkeys with lesions of dorsolateral prefrontal cortex (Group DL) served as controls. Group VM was severely impaired on a test of object recognition, whereas Group DL did not differ appreciably from normal animals. Conversely, the animals in Group VM were able to learn a spatial delayed response task, whereas 2 of the 3 animals in Group DL could not. Neither group was impaired in the acquisition of visual discrimination habits, even though the successive trials on a given discrimination were separated by 24-h intervals. The patterns of deficit suggest that ventromedial prefrontal cortex constitutes another station in the limbothalamic system underlying cognitive memory processes, whereas the dorsolateral prefrontal cortex lies outside this system. The results support the view that the classical delayed-response deficit observed after dorsolateral prefrontal lesions represents a perceptuo-mnemonic impairment in spatial functions selectively rather than a memory loss of a more general nature.  相似文献

The influence of angiotensin II (ANGII) on the dynamic characteristics of renal blood flow (RBF) was studied in conscious dogs by testing the response to a step increase in renal artery pressure (RAP) after a 60 s period of pressure reduction (to 50 mmHg) and by calculating the transfer function between physiological fluctuations in RAP and RBF. During the RAP reduction, renal vascular resistance (RVR) decreased and upon rapid restoration of RAP, RVR returned to baseline with a characteristic time course: within the first 10 s, RVR rose rapidly by 40 % of the initial change (first response, myogenic response). A second rise began after 20–30 s and reached baseline after an overshoot at 40 s (second response, tubuloglomerular feedback (TGF)). Between both responses, RVR rose very slowly (plateau). The transfer function had a low gain below 0.01 Hz (high autoregulatory efficiency) and two corner frequencies at 0.026 Hz (TGF) and at 0.12 Hz (myogenic response). Inhibition of angiotensin converting enzyme (ACE) lowered baseline RVR, but not the minimum RVR at the end of the RAP reduction (autoregulation-independent RVR). Both the first and second response were reduced, but the normalised level of the plateau (balance between myogenic response, TGF and possible slower mechanisms) and the transfer gain below 0.01 Hz were not affected. Infusion of ANGII after ramipril raised baseline RVR above the control condition. The first and second response and the transfer gain at both corner frequencies were slightly augmented, but the normalised level of the plateau was not affected. It is concluded that alterations of plasma ANGII within a physiological range do not modulate the relative contribution of the myogenic response to the overall short-term autoregulation of RBF. Consequently, it appears that ANGII augments not only TGF, but also the myogenic response.  相似文献

Objective. The Ciba Corning 512 coagulation monitor (CC512) can be used to monitor heparin therapy by performing an activated partial thromboplastin time (APTT) at the patient’s bedside. This study was designed to compare the CC512 results to results using the laboratory system. The relative sensitivities of both systems to the effect of oral anticoagulant therapy also was investigated.Methods. Activated partial thromboplastin times were performed with both the CC512 and laboratory system on 74 specimens from patients receiving IV heparin therapy, and on 14 specimens from patients on warfarin only. Heparin assays were performed on 43 of the specimens from the heparinized patients.Results. When a patient was receiving heparin only, the APTT results of the CC512 proved to be similar to existing laboratory methods. The CC512 APTT results of patients on warfarin only were markedly prolonged, whereas the laboratory APTTs were only slightly affected.Conclusion. The CC512 results were comparable to the laboratory system. However, the CC512 APTT was more sensitive to the effect of warfarin than the laboratory APTT system used in this study. CC512 APTT results on a patient receiving both oral and intravenous anticoagulation could be misleading. The authors wish to thank D.M.
